To obtain a silver halide photographic sensitive material high in sensitivity and superior in storage stability by incorporating a compound having plural styryl bases combined through covalent bonds.
This photographic sensitive material contains a compound having ≥2 styryl bases combined through covalent bonds and represented by formula I: A1-L-A2 in which each of A1 and A2 has a styryl base structure; and L is a simple bond or a divalent bonding group; or formula I is selected from groups of formula II and the like, and in formula II, each of Z1 and Z2 is an atomic group necessary to form a 5- or 6-membered N-containing hetero ring; each of L1-L8 is a methine group; each of V1 and V2 is a univalent bonding group; each of l1 and l2 is 0, 1, 2, 3, or 4; each of p1 and p2 is 0 or 1; each of n1 and n2 is 0, 1, 2, or 3; each of R1 and R2 is an H atom or an alkyl group or the like; M1 is a charge balancing counter ion; m1 is a number of 0-10 necessary to neutraliz the molecular charge; and La is same as L in formula I.
